Skeletal Muscle Fibers

Myocyte: Skeletal muscle cell

Myocyte: Skeletal muscle cell

A skeletal muscle cell is surrounded by a plasma membrane called the sarcolemma with a cytoplasm called the sarcoplasm. A muscle fiber is composed of many myofibrils, packaged into orderly units.
